  • Abstract
    This paper presents a new approach to develop personal agent. The communication and cooperation between agents are done using DAML ontology that facilitates integration of services of different domains. Furthermore, because that rules can be described in the DAML ontology, agents can infer from it and collaborate intelligently to achieve user´s goal. An example of advanced traveler information system (ATIS) is included.
